Santas Without Chimneys Santas Without Chimneys Santas Without Chimneys is a secular entirely volunteerrun 501c3 nonprofit that works with schools and social workers to provide holiday gifts to homeless and highly mobile children and youth in the Madison area. We collect wishlists from each child or teen 555 in 2022. so that everyone can receive a sack of gifts just for them.
